The product is built around a strict pipeline. If the evidence is not comparable, we publish nothing.
Use official or clearly licensed public data and retain source URL, release date and provenance.
Store the value as it appeared in a specific publication release rather than silently replacing history.
Require the same entity, indicator, reference period, compatible unit and validated methodology.
Revision size, direction and histories are calculated by code. LLMs do not invent numerical facts.
One canonical object feeds human HTML, JSON, CSV and structured metadata so outputs cannot drift.
Stable URLs expose raw values, calculation, method, update timestamp and source attribution.
